Based in our Austin, Texas location, you will be welcomed into a diverse community and work as a member of one of the cross-functional agile teams responsible for the development of the DeltaV Process Control System.

DeltaV is the state of the art, flagship distributed process control system used by many of the top companies in chemical, life sciences and energy industries. It consists of a variety of rich desktop and web applications used for engineering and operating a process control system, plus real-time embedded firmware in controllers and field devices directly controlling the process.  Successful applicants would be expected to have experience testing real-time embedded firmware and applications and have experience in software testing and test automation.
